一.HIMA F8650E Core Features
Dual-CPU Operation for Fault Tolerance
The F8650E employs dual Intel 386EX 32-bit microprocessors operating at 25 MHz, ensuring continuous system availability even during hardware failures. This synchronized redundancy allows seamless failover without interrupting critical processes, making it ideal for high-risk environments like combustion furnace control and pipeline monitoring.
SIL 3-Certified Safety Architecture
Certified for Safety Integrity Level 3 (SIL 3) under IEC 61508, the module integrates fail-safe mechanisms such as watchdog timers and fault-detection circuits. Its design meets rigorous safety protocols for industries requiring zero downtime, including oil/gas and power generation.
Multi-Protocol Communication Interfaces
Equipped with dual electrically isolated RS-485 ports, the module supports Profibus, Modbus, and Ethernet/IP protocols. This ensures interoperability with diverse control systems while maintaining data integrity in electrically noisy environments.
Secure Firmware Management
Configuration and updates are managed via SILworX or ELOP II tools, ensuring compliance with evolving safety standards. A dedicated reset key mechanism safeguards against unauthorized settings changes during IP conflicts or credential mismatches.
